Most organisations don't suffer from a lack of customer data. They suffer from having too much of it. Every purchase, support conversation, website visit, chatbot interaction and marketing touchpoint generates valuable information. Yet much of that data remains scattered across CRMs, contact centre platforms, marketing tools and operational systems, owned by different teams and rarely joined up.

The challenge is no longer collecting customer data, but connecting it, understanding it and turning it into better decisions. That's where customer data intelligence comes in.

Defining Customer Data Intelligence

Put simply, customer data intelligence is about helping organisations make sense of everything they already know about a customer, and using that understanding to decide what to do next. Traditional reporting looks backward at what already happened. Customer data intelligence looks at a customer right now, and asks what the organisation should do about it.

Why Customer Data Intelligence Matters Now

The idea itself isn't new. Businesses have talked about "knowing the customer" for decades. What's changed is what AI now expects from that knowledge.

Previously, organisations collected customer data mainly for reporting and marketing campaigns. A dashboard here, a segment list there. Today, AI systems need something different. A support copilot answering a billing question needs to know what that customer bought, and how the last conversation ended. An AI agent authorised to issue a refund needs enough context to make that call responsibly.

That has turned connected customer data from a nice-to-have into a requirement. AI doesn't just consume customer data anymore. It depends on it. Gartner reaches a similar conclusion in its research on CRM and agentic AI, arguing that AI-ready customer data has become a high bar organisations must clear before they can fully realise what agentic AI can do.

Why Customer Data has Become More Complex

Think about the last time you bought something online. You might have researched it on your phone, added it to a basket, asked a chatbot about delivery costs, abandoned the purchase, then come back three days later on a different device to finish it. When it arrived late, you emailed support. A week after that, you rang to arrange a return.

To you, that was one experience. Inside the business, it was probably six. The product research sat in an analytics tool. The chatbot conversation sat in a bot platform. The purchase sat in the commerce system. The delivery complaint sat in a ticketing tool. The return sat somewhere else again. Nobody inside the organisation necessarily saw the whole story, because nobody's job was to look at all six systems at once.

That's the real problem. It isn't a lack of data. It's too much of it, scattered too widely, understood by too few people at any given moment.

The Building Blocks of Customer Data Intelligence

It helps to think of this as a progression rather than a single project. Raw data becomes valuable once it's connected across sources. Connected data becomes a profile once records are resolved to the same person. A profile becomes useful once AI analyses it and produces something a business can act on. Skip a step, and the whole thing breaks down.

Customer identity comes first. The organisation needs to recognise that the person calling support today is the same customer who placed an order yesterday and browsed the returns page this morning. Get that wrong, and everything built on top of it inherits the error.

From there, a unified profile pulls together what a customer has done, what they've said and how they've behaved: purchases and billing, support conversations and chats, browsing and product usage. AI analyses all three together, spotting patterns and recommending the next best action.

How AI Changes Customer Data

A retailer notices that a customer has viewed the same jacket three times this week, added it to her basket twice, and abandoned it both times. She also messaged support two days ago to ask about delivery costs, and returned a different item last month.

Treated separately, those are four unremarkable events. Treated together, they tell a story. The customer wants the jacket, delivery cost is the sticking point, and her recent return may have made her cautious about buying again. An AI system that can see all four events at once can act on that story by offering free delivery before she abandons the basket a third time, rather than emailing her a generic discount code a week later, once she's already bought it elsewhere.

Better-connected data, acted on while it still matters, is what makes that possible, not simply more of it.

Customer Data Intelligence vs Customer Data Platforms

Understanding the difference between these terms matters because they often get used interchangeably when they shouldn't be.

A customer data platform, or CDP, stores and unifies customer data. Customer data intelligence uses that data to generate insight and action. A simple way to picture the difference is that a CDP is the library and customer data intelligence is the researcher who reads the books and explains what they mean.

It's also worth noting that customer data intelligence can draw on systems beyond a CDP, including CRM, contact centre, commerce and operational platforms. A CDP can be part of the picture without being the whole of it.

Customer Data Intelligence vs Single Customer View

A related and equally common confusion is between customer data intelligence and a single customer view.

Many organisations treat building a single customer view as the end point of their customer data strategy. But a single customer view only answers one question: who is this customer? Customer data intelligence goes further. It asks what that information tells the business, and what it should do next. A unified profile is the foundation. It was never the destination.

Common Challenges

None of this happens automatically. Poor data quality, duplicate records and data silos remain common obstacles, problems many organisations still get wrong when trying to build AI on top of their data. These challenges are far from theoretical. Gartner has found that 63% of organisations either lack, or aren't sure they have, AI-ready data management practices, and predicts that through 2026, 60% of AI projects unsupported by AI-ready data will be abandoned. Privacy, consent and governance add real constraints, not just paperwork. Legacy systems make real-time integration harder than it sounds. And unclear ownership, nobody quite responsible for the data itself, can stall a project before it starts.

Buying another platform is often the easy part. Agreeing who owns the data is usually much harder, and it takes governance, shared ownership across departments, and standards everyone follows.

The Future of Customer Data Intelligence

Five years ago, most organisations were trying to build a single customer view. Today, they're trying to give AI enough context to make good decisions. That's a different challenge, and a harder one to finish.

Real-time context and persistent customer memory are both part of the same direction of travel. Many organisations support these capabilities with techniques such as retrieval-augmented generation (RAG), which grounds AI responses in verified company knowledge rather than model memory alone. None of it works unless the underlying customer data has already been connected.

Customer data is becoming less like a database and more like a living system: something that updates itself as new information arrives, rather than something a team refreshes once a quarter.

Frequently Asked Questions

Is customer data intelligence the same as a customer data platform? No. A CDP stores and unifies customer data. Customer data intelligence is what happens next; analysing that data with AI to generate insight and decide on action. A business can own a CDP and still lack customer data intelligence if nobody, human or AI, is doing anything with what it holds.

Do you need a CDP to do customer data intelligence? Not necessarily. Customer data intelligence can draw on a CDP, but it can equally draw on CRM, contact centre, commerce and operational systems directly, particularly where AI is retrieving context in real time rather than relying on one central database.

How is customer data intelligence different from a single customer view? A single customer view aims to answer ‘who is this customer?’. Customer data intelligence goes further, using that same data to work out what the business should do for them next.

Why does customer data intelligence matter for AI agents? An AI agent making a decision, such as approving a refund or recommending a product, is only as good as the context behind it. Without connected customer data, an agent is guessing. With it, an agent can make a decision grounded in what actually happened.
